Sat 1279575042330660

decimal
301830.42330660
degree
0°91830′1446″42330660‴
percentile
60.932144939913954%
name
eubrxuubcqf
cycle
0
epoch
1
period
149
block
301830
offset
42330660
timestamp
rarity
common